Is “Secular” Inherently Political? The Core Argument

The crux of the debate lies in whether the term "secular" itself carries an inherent political bias. Proponents of the clue argue that "secular" is a neutral descriptor, simply denoting something non-religious. They point to the existence of secular governments, secular education systems, and secular music as examples where the term is used without necessarily implying an anti-religious stance. Opponents, however, contend that the very act of highlighting the non-religious nature of something can be interpreted as a subtle endorsement of secularism, a worldview that prioritizes reason and evidence over faith. Crossword Puzzle Tradition: Neutrality vs. Relevance

Crossword puzzles have long prided themselves on their ability to test solvers' knowledge across a wide spectrum of subjects. From history and literature to science and pop culture, a good crossword should offer a diverse range of challenges. However, there's an unspoken agreement that puzzles should generally avoid overtly partisan or divisive topics. The debate surrounding the secular clue has forced a re-evaluation of this tradition. Is it possible to incorporate contemporary issues and relevant social concepts without crossing the line into political advocacy? Some crossword constructors are pushing the boundaries, arguing that puzzles should reflect the world we live in, even if that means occasionally tackling sensitive subjects. Others maintain that puzzles should remain a safe haven from the noise and fury of the political arena.
